Lecture Notes-Chapter 29

Chapter 29 discusses the behavior of charged particles in magnetic fields, including the forces exerted on them and their motion. It covers concepts such as Hall effect and the relationship between velocity and magnetic fields. The chapter also includes mathematical formulations relevant to the motion of particles in these fields.
